How much do home inspectors j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 7, 2026, the average yearly pay for home inspectors in Rochester, NY is $59,541.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$47,400.00 and $69,600.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

How long does it take to become a home inspector?

Becoming a home inspector typically requires completing a state-approved training program that ranges from 40 to 140 hours, followed by passing a certification exam. The process can take several weeks to a few months depending on the program and scheduling, and some states also require additional experience or licensing steps.

Is there a demand for home inspectors?

Home inspectors are in steady demand due to the ongoing need for property evaluations during real estate transactions. The profession requires certification and knowledge of building codes, and employment opportunities are often influenced by the housing market and regional development activity.

What is the difference between Home Inspectors vs Real Estate Agents?

AspectHome InspectorsReal Estate Agents
Required CredentialsCertification or licensing varies by state, often requiring training and examsReal estate license, obtained through coursework and exams
Work EnvironmentConduct inspections on residential or commercial properties, often on-siteAssist clients in buying or selling properties, primarily office and client meetings
Industry UsageFocus on property condition assessmentsFocus on property sales and client representation

Home Inspectors and Real Estate Agents both work within the property industry but serve different roles. Home Inspectors evaluate property conditions, requiring specific certifications, and work on-site during property assessments. Real Estate Agents facilitate property transactions, holding licenses and working primarily in sales and client negotiations. Understanding these differences helps clients find the right professional for their needs.

Licensed Nursing Home Administrator 

Facility: Houghton Rehabilitation & Nursing Center

Compensation:

Pay: $125,000 Up to $135,000 per year (With Benefits)

Position Purpose: Supervises all clinical and administrative functions within the nursing facility along with developing and implementing management systems. Responsible for the overall financial management of facility, maintains budget and building census, ensures compliance with all Federal, State, and company regulations and policies. Must have excellent communication and team building skills. Must be able to effectively manage several departments to ensure facility cohesiveness.

Educational Requirements: Bachelor’s degree is required; Master’s degree in business, health care administration, public health or related area is preferred. accredited educational institution, including (or supplemented by) 15 credit hours of specific education, which includes completing a course in nursing home administration.

Experience Required: Minimum 1 year of long term care facility experience preferred. Strong work ethic, intense drive, and initiative for quality and customer service. Excellent written & oral communication skills. Excellent problem-solving skills. Understanding of budgeting processes, awareness of profit & loss concepts. Excellent administrative and organizational skills and an ability to prioritize. Strong stress management skills required.

Professional Licensure and Certification Required: Current NY State Licensed Nursing Home Administrator (LNHA) certification,

Essential Functions

  1. Supervises all clinical and administrative staff and functions within the facility
  2. Develops and implements facility management systems
  3. Management, supervision, and coordination of all departments to ensure the delivery of quality care
  4. Manages facility finances and oversees departmental budgets
  5. Ensures facility compliance with all Federal, State and company policies and regulations
  6. Oversee all employee relations to include recruitment, orientation, performance evaluations, disciplinary actions, terminations, training, staff development and enforcement of policies and procedures
  7. Ensures compliance with resident rights and works to resolve grievances
  8. Coordinates preparations for inspections (surveys) conducted by authorized agencies
  9. Performs rounds to observe care and to interview staff, residents, families or other interested parties
  10. Performs institutional rounds to ensure that facility is compliant with Federal, State and local regulations
  11. Oversees and participates in quality assurance and improvement processes within the facility
  12. Demonstrates the mission, vision, and values of the facility through professional excellence.
  13. Exhibits calm behavior during emergency situations.
  14. Exhibits professional conduct and behavior through cooperative interactions with others and accepts personal responsibility for their own actions.

Personnel Functions

  1. Oversees all department’s schedules to assure they meet resident needs; also monitors regulatory and budgetary standards.
  2. Participates in the recruitment and selection of all department personnel and assures sufficient staff are hired.
  3. Ensures that the development and delivery of in-service education to equip all staff with sufficient knowledge and skills to provide compassionate, quality care and respect for resident rights.
  4. Evaluates the work performance of all personnel, assists in the determination of wage increases and implements discipline according to operational policies.
  5. Assures staff is trained in fire, disaster and other emergency Evaluates staff performance during drills.
  6. Proactively develops positive employee relations, incentives and recognition ; promotes teamwork, mutual respect and effective communication.
